My setup to facilitate a NAIT PVS-14:
Ops Core Fast Bump
Norotos RHNO II mount + Dual Dovetail adapter
TNVC Mohawk MK1 counterweight using two out of four bars of weights supplied
Agilite cover
Core Survival Hel Star 6
Surefire M1 in a VTAC mount
Wilcox/TNVC lanyard
I haven’t ran this setup under live fire yet, but I go stargazing nearly every night and run around in the backyard to see if all of the incremental accessory addition throws off the balance. Huge thanks to Outlander Systems for hooking up a ton of supplemental gear when I bought his PVS-14.
